Home Remedies For Bloating, Easy and Simple Natural Cure


Swelling of the abdominal area due to gas or excessive liquid is known as bloating. The tightened abdomen can cause discomfort and can make it really difficult to either sit down or walk around. Crohn's disease and gastrointestinal tract affliction can also cause bloating. It can also cause sharp pain in the stomach. Some common symptoms of bloating are; fatigue, darkened stool, chest pain, stomach discomfort, diarrhea, indigestion, vomiting, breathing problem and difficulty in burping and swallowing.

Bloating Home Remedies

There are several home remedies for bloating which can be very effective if followed properly. Some of the common home remedies for bloating are:

1. One of the most effective home remedies for bloating is the consumption of ginger tea. Consuming ginger tea soothes bloating by leaving a warming effect on the digestive system. This warming effect results into digestive enzyme production which enhances and improves food digestion.

2. Consuming a mixture of grounded cinnamon, honey and water on regular basis is also very helpful in relieving the discomfort caused by bloating.

3. Bay leaves are also very helpful in causing relief from bloating. Just boil a cup of water and then add bay leaf to this water. Wait for five minutes and drink the entire cup in one setting. Remember not to lie down for at least one hour after consuming this mixture. Staying in upright position will help the gas to come out quicker.

4. Chamomile tea is considered to be one of the efficient home remedies for bloating. All you need to do is consume chamomile tea twice daily. One in the morning and one just before going to bed.

5. Peppermint tea is also one of the effective home remedies for bloating. It relaxes your body muscles and allows your body to release digestive gas. Just boil a cup of water with some dried peppermint leaves (one teaspoon) in it. Let it boil for ten minutes and then strain this tea. Drink this tea for four to five times daily. This tea is more effective if you consume it before meals.

6. Turmeric is also very effective in treating bloating. It is rich in nutrients and vitamins such as protein, folic acid, iron, vitamin C and calcium. These vitamins and nutrients help to improve the functioning of the digestive system.

7. Fennel tea is known to have digestive properties and is very effective in giving relief from bloating.

8. Drink plenty of water and eat fruits and green leafy vegetables. Buttermilk is also very helpful in fighting bloating.

9. Avoid eating troublesome foods such as celery, beans, milk products, apricots and Brussels sprout. Do not drink carbonated beverages.

10. Avoid tobacco products and smoking.

11. Carom seeds are known to have thymol which acts as an antibacterial and is very effective in curing problems of digestive system. Therefore consuming carom seeds mixed in water with some black salt can be very helpful in treating bloating.

12. Cardamom is also one of the effective home remedies for bloating. It stabilizes the acids of your stomach and is very helpful in treating bloating.
